![]() So, if you have a document that you’ve lost, and you aren’t sure of the title, you can search using a word that you know is in the body of the document. On a Mac, Spotlight can be used to search your hard drive for any file, folder, or email based on the search criteria being in the title or the body. ![]() This article will outline some of the benefits of using Spotlight and how to use Smart Folders, which allow you to search for a file even if you don’t know its name. Spotlight is also capable of looking up dictionary definitions, launching apps, performing calculations, previewing audio, video, documents, and other files. ![]() There are many other things Spotlight can do, and searching for files is just one of them. ![]() In OS X, Spotlight is an effective way to search your entire hard drive for a file or folder, email, or any other file. ![]()
